Comprehensive Cultivation Guide
Cultivating Perfect Totality requires careful attention to detail, from clone selection to final harvest, ensuring that every plant meets the high standards set by Enlightened Genetics. Growers are advised to maintain a controlled environment with temperatures ranging between 68°F and 77°F to support optimal enzymatic activity during growth.
When cultivating in indoor environments, a humidity level between 40% and 50% is ideal, reducing the risk of mold while promoting robust growth. This strain thrives under a well-fitted LED or HPS lighting system, with growers reporting yields of up to 500 grams per square meter under optimal conditions, based on recent studies.
Plant nutrition is vital for the success of Perfect Totality. A balanced nutrient regimen that includes nitrogen (N), phosphorus (P), and potassium (K) in the ratio of 2:1:2 during the vegetative phase has been found to enhance plant health. During the flowering phase, transitioning to a nutrient formula with reduced nitrogen and increased phosphorus and potassium can boost bud development, leading to improved potency and aroma.
Techniques such as low-stress training (LST) and topping can be beneficial for this strain, as they help in managing growth and ensuring an even canopy. Environmental control is key to maintain a steady flowering cycle that typically lasts between 8 to 10 weeks, ensuring that trichome production is maximized.
In outdoor settings, growers should select a location with ample sunlight – ideally, 6 to 8 hours of uninterrupted sunlight per day. Soil quality plays a critical role, and organic-rich soils with a pH between 6.0 and 7.0 have shown to significantly enhance growth, dramatically improving harvest quality.
Regular monitoring for pests and nutrient deficiencies is crucial; integrated pest management (IPM) practices have proven effective in reducing infestation risks by over 40% in controlled studies. Additionally, implementing proper flushing techniques two weeks before harvest can ensure a cleaner taste profile and reduce chemical residues, as recommended by expert cultivators.
Advanced growers may also choose to employ precision irrigation systems that provide consistent water delivery, which is essential for maintaining optimal root health and overall plant vigor. Recent technological advancements in automated grow systems have enabled cultivators to maintain water and nutrient levels within a 3% variance, ensuring consistent quality even in larger scale operations.
Furthermore, perfect cultivation of Perfect Totality requires attention to genetic stability; as such, maintaining a clean and sterile environment during the cloning phase can improve survival rates by 15-20%. Enlightened Genetics recommends that growers document each cycle using detailed data logging, including yield statistics, nutrient uptake, and environmental conditions.
Such meticulous record-keeping not only aids in replicating a successful yield but also provides valuable data that contributes to broader industry research and continuous genetic improvements. Experienced cultivators have reported that plants grown under these guidelines often display more uniform bud structure and enhanced cannabinoid consistency, elements crucial for both medicinal and recreational markets.
